Position Description:
CGI Federal is seeking a talented and motivated Intermediate Level SharePoint Developer to join our dynamic team.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in SharePoint development, including customization, integration, and administration. This role involves working closely with clients and team members to design, develop, and implement SharePoint solutions that meet business needs and enhance productivity.
This position is located in Ft. Belvoir, VA.
Required qualifications to be successful in this role:
Education:
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, or a related field or Associates with 7+ years of experience
Due to the nature of the work, US citizenship and a secret security clearance are required
Experience:Minimum of 5+ years of experience in SharePoint development and administration.
Experience with SharePoint Online, SharePoint 2016/2019, and Office 365.
Technical Skills:
Proficiency in SharePoint Designer, Visual Studio, and PowerShell.
Strong knowledge of SharePoint frameworks, including SPFx, CSOM, JSOM, and REST API.
Experience with front-end technologies, such as H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and jQuery.
Familiarity with back-end development using C# and .NET.
Experience with SharePoint workflows, forms (InfoPath, PowerApps), and automation (Power Automate).

Your future duties and responsibilities:
SharePoint Development:
Design, develop, and customize SharePoint solutions, including web parts, workflows, forms, and templates.
Implement and configure SharePoint features, including site collections, sites, lists, libraries, and content types.
Integration and Migration:
Integrate SharePoint with other enterprise systems and applications.
Perform data migration and content management tasks, ensuring data integrity and consistency.
Administration and Maintenance:
Manage and maintain SharePoint environments, including security, performance, and availability.
Monitor and troubleshoot SharePoint issues, providing timely resolution and support.
Collaboration and Communication:
Work closely with clients, business analysts, and team members to gather requirements and translate them into technical solutions.
Provide training and support to end-users, ensuring they can effectively use SharePoint solutions.
Documentation and Best Practices:
Develop and maintain technical documentation, including design specifications, user guides, and operational procedures.
Follow industry best practices and CGI standards for SharePoint development and administration.
